A technical report is a formal/comprehensive/detailed document that presents the results of a investigation/study/analysis. It typically covers an extensive/specific/narrow range of topics related to a particular problem/project/issue, outlining findings, conclusions, and recommendations in a clear and concise manner. Technical reports often utilize charts, graphs, and tables to illustrate data, trends, and patterns. They are frequently used in academia, industry, and government to communicate technical information, check here support decision-making, and document progress.

A Safety Technical Report
A safety technical report is a crucial document that examines potential hazards and presents the necessary measures to mitigate risks in a particular work environment. It typically encompasses a thorough examination of existing safety procedures, identifies areas of concern, and suggests suitable solutions to ensure the safety of personnel. The report should be clear and accessible to all relevant individuals, allowing them to understand the potential dangers and the steps required to maintain a safe working setting.
